The station is streamlined for efficiency, despite not housing a ticket office. Travelers can easily collect or purchase their tickets from the convenient machines, accessible through major debit and credit cards. While the station might lack first-class lounges, and certain luxuries like refreshment facilities and toilets, it makes up for it with essential amenities designed for ease of use. Step-free access is available, although it’s recommended to plan ahead addressing any mobility constraints, considering the steep ramp on premises.
Whether you're a first-timer or a seasoned rail traveler, Barry Docks offers practical resources. Although direct human assistance onboard the station is absent, informative help points, and screens for arrivals and departements keep you updated. Assistance for those who might need a helping hand while traveling can be arranged through the Passenger Assist service, enhancing your overall travel experience.

Despite its modest size, Whitwell (Derbyshire) station offers a good range of facilities to ensure a hassle-free journey. Although there is no ticket office, travellers can easily purchase and collect tickets from accessible machines. The station supports smartcards with the available validators, though it's worth noting smartcards cannot be issued at the station itself.
For those requiring assistance, a help point is available, alongside customer help points to guide you through your travel needs. CCTV is active, ensuring security throughout your visit. Accessibility features are a key aspect here, with step-free access to platform 1, while platform 2 is accessible via a ramped footbridge, all while offering tactile paving at platform edges.
